- What is Prospect Capital's net asset value?
- Prospect Capital (PSEC) reported net asset value of $6.05 in Q1 2026.
- How has Prospect Capital's net asset value changed year-over-year?
- Prospect Capital's net asset value decreased by 16.6% year-over-year, from $7.25 to $6.05.
- What is the long-term trend for Prospect Capital's net asset value?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Prospect Capital's net asset value has grown at a -9.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$9.81 to $6.56.
- What does net asset value mean?
- This is the total net asset value of the company divided by the number of outstanding shares, representing the intrinsic value of a single share. It is a fundamental metric for valuation, allowing investors to compare the market price of the stock against the underlying value of the company's investment portfolio. A premium or discount to this value often signals market sentiment regarding the company's management and asset quality.
